Output 40545ba84a9d971594a5c8b7aa67b1d2dfd31f3cc4a5e8ef064216290f6173e3:0

value
2999809
script pubkey
OP_HASH160 OP_PUSHBYTES_20 856ac72c2126e2b05b55b039e8ef801ff35c285a OP_EQUAL
address
3DrTi892nQCuupNp6YbBJVcu9Fowiwiufw
transaction
40545ba84a9d971594a5c8b7aa67b1d2dfd31f3cc4a5e8ef064216290f6173e3
spent
true